Ginger Gadchiroli Mul Road: A New Era of Hospitality and Connectivity in Maharashtra

June 28, 2026
Ginger Gadchiroli Mul Road: A New Era of Hospitality and Connectivity in Maharashtra

Maharashtra’s tourism landscape has received a significant boost with the opening of the latest Ginger Hotels property, the Ginger Gadchiroli located on Mul Road. This development marks a meaningful expansion for the Indian Hotels Company Limited (IHCL) as it aims to strengthen its presence in emerging markets within the Indian state, meeting the rising demand for modern yet affordable accommodations in growing regions.

The newly launched hotel features 34 contemporary rooms, providing guests with access to modern amenities and a sleek design that aligns with the Ginger brand’s signature lean-luxe philosophy. Situated in an area poised for infrastructural growth, this hotel will cater to both business travelers and government officials needing comfortable accommodations close to commercial hubs.

Strengthening IHCL’s Footprint in Maharashtra

With the launch of Ginger Gadchiroli, IHCL has successfully extended the brand’s footprint in Maharashtra to a total of fifteen hotels. This strategic expansion comes at a time when the state is witnessing heightened demand for hospitality services, not just in well-established cities like Mumbai, Pune, and Nagpur, but increasingly in smaller districts such as Gadchiroli, which is on the rise due to improved connectivity and infrastructure.

Gadchiroli is quickly evolving into a key administrative and commercial district, making it an attractive target for organized hospitality. The establishment of Ginger Hotels in this area ensures IHCL capitalizes on early branding opportunities, aiding in the long-term growth of the market as it develops.

Modern Amenities and Dining Options

The Ginger Gadchiroli hotel boasts not only stylish and functional rooms but also includes Qmin, the brand’s signature all-day dining restaurant. This dining option serves a variety of Indian and international cuisine, providing guests with a convenient and reliable place to dine during their stay. An on-site bar adds an extra layer of relaxation and social engagement for visitors, making it an attractive feature for work-related trips.

Tourism Potential in Gadchiroli

While the immediate focus relies on meetings and business travel, Gadchiroli also possesses significant tourism potential. Described by Maharashtra Tourism as a haven of dense forests, rugged hills, and pristine rivers, the area is primed for adventure tourism. Opportunities for trekking, camping, and cultural experiences await intrepid travelers, making it an attractive destination for those seeking nature-based escapes.
